浅谈自定义vscode扩展插件路径的方法「windows环境」

1. 前言

Visual Studio Code(以下简称VS Code)是一款基于Electron平台(跨平台框架)的免费开源代码编辑器。由于其插件丰富、易扩展、跨平台等特点,VS Code逐渐成为了开发者首选的代码编辑器之一。在使用VS Code进行开发过程中,我们可能需要使用各种扩展插件,但默认情况下VS Code安装的插件都存储在同一个目录下。使用默认的目录存储插件,对于多个人共同开发或多平台使用的情况并不友好,故本文将介绍在windows环境下,如何自定义VS Code扩展插件路径的方法。

2. 修改扩展插件路径

2.1 查找VS Code配置文件

在修改VS Code扩展插件路径之前,需要先找到VS Code的配置文件,配置文件存储在不同的位置,具体取决于VS Code的安装平台和版本。在windows环境下,VS Code配置文件通常存储在以下路径中:

%APPDATA%\Code\User

其中%APPDATA%是windows环境中系统数据存储位置的环境变量,具体的路径会根据不同的windows系统版本而有所不同。

2.2 修改settings.json文件

在VS Code的配置文件夹中,有一个名为settings.json的文件,该文件用于存储VS Code的所有个性化设置。我们可以通过修改settings.json文件来达到自定义扩展插件路径的目的。

首先,在VS Code中打开settings.json文件。具体步骤如下:

打开VS Code

打开命令面板(快捷键为Ctrl+Shift+P

在命令面板中输入Preferences: Open Settings (JSON)

找到settings.json文件后,我们需要在其中添加如下代码:

"extensions.installPath": "插件存储路径"

注意:

插件存储路径为您想自定义的存储路径,需替换成您自己的路径

路径需要使用正斜杠"/",而不是反斜杠"\\"

若存储路径中有空格,需要用双引号括起来

添加上述代码后,我们需要保存settings.json文件的修改,重启VS Code后生效。

3. 自定义扩展插件路径的优势

将扩展插件存储到自定义路径下,主要有以下几点优势:

3.1 允许团队成员共享扩展插件

当多个人共同参与一个项目的开发时,团队中的每个人都需要安装相同的扩展插件。使用自定义路径存储扩展插件,团队中的每个人都可以从相同的路径中安装扩展插件,避免了各自安装相同插件的麻烦,提高了团队开发效率。

3.2 方便管理多个VS Code版本的扩展插件

在同一台电脑上,可能有多个VS Code版本的开发环境,安装不同版本的VS Code也可能会导致同一扩展插件的版本不同。使用自定义路径存储扩展插件,可以方便地管理各个版本的VS Code的扩展插件,避免了版本管理混乱的问题。

3.3 方便迁移开发环境

如果需要迁移开发环境到另一台电脑上或从一台电脑上卸载VS Code并重新安装,使用自定义路径存储扩展插件,可以方便地将插件迁移到新的开发环境中,避免重新安装和配置的烦恼。

4. 总结

本文介绍了在windows环境下,如何自定义VS Code扩展插件路径的方法。通过修改settings.json文件,我们可以将扩展插件存储到自定义路径下,从而允许团队共享扩展插件、方便管理多个VS Code版本的扩展插件以及方便迁移开发环境等。

免责声明:本文来自互联网,本站所有信息(包括但不限于文字、视频、音频、数据及图表),不保证该信息的准确性、真实性、完整性、有效性、及时性、原创性等,版权归属于原作者,如无意侵犯媒体或个人知识产权,请来电或致函告之,本站将在第一时间处理。猿码集站发布此文目的在于促进信息交流,此文观点与本站立场无关,不承担任何责任。